Anza-Borrego Foundation, the nonprofit partner of AnzaBorrrego Desert State Park, welcomes HEYDAY books author Obi Kaufmann for a book signing celebrating the release of The California Field Atlas. The lavishly illustrated California Field Atlas takes readers off the beaten path and outside normal conceptions of California, revealing its myriad ecologies, topographies, and histories in exquisite maps and trail paintings. Chapter six of the Atlas, called “Of Life, Death and the Desert" – is an exploration of California’s three deserts: The Sonoran, the Mojave and the Great Basin, in watercolor maps and vividly-depicted, wildlife paintings. Obi will be donating two paintings in a silent auction to benefit Anza-Borrego Foundation and their work supporting Anza-Borrego Desert State Park. His appearance is part of the #trackingthunderbirds tour of California celebrating the publishing of the book. Growing up in the East Bay as the son of an astrophysicist and a psychologist, Obi Kaufmann spent most of high school practicing calculus and breaking away on weekends to scramble around Mount Diablo and map its creeks, oak forests, and sage mazes. Into adulthood, he would regularly journey into the mountains, spending more summer nights without a roof than with one. For Kaufmann, the epic narrative of the California backcountry holds enough art, science, mythology, and language for a hundred field atlases to come. When he is not backpacking, you can find the painter-poet at his desk in Oakland, posting @ coyotethunder #trailpaintings on social media. His website is www.coyoteandthunder.com. Warrior Foundation / Freedom Station Breakfast At The Legion Over 200 served was the word from the Sons of the American Legion after Sunday mornings annual breakfast/fund raiser for the Warrior Foundation/Freedom Station. The amount of donations to the cause was not available but will be tabulated over the next week. If it’s anything like years past the amount will exceed all expectations. This event now in its’ eleventh year, featured the outstanding food and two bands, Malaki and The Good tones to keep everyone fed and entertained throughout the morning. SAL members were jammin’ in the kitchen and selling tickets as fast as they could peel them off, and many folks donated their change. As a result they are one of the top rated charity organizations in the country. Consider this, prior to the opening of Freedom Station their rate of contribution to their clients was 100%. Though the organization has grown, their official contribution to their clients is now 92.5%. The other 7.5% is set asides for the running and maintenance of Freedom Station so in essence, in one form or another, all the money still goes to the Warriors.
